Vancouver, BC singer/songwriter Nicholas Krgovich returns with Boss Tape, his first solo release since 2023’s Ducks LP. Self-produced & recorded at home & at the Wise Hall in Vancouver, BC, Boss Tape is a collection of Bruce Springsteen covers.

Happy April 8th! Here is the original artwork for "On Avery Island". Hand colored with pastels and taped onto multiple sheets of red construction paper by Jeff Mangum.

We covered a classic by NZ / Flying Nun legends Look Blue Go Purple for a tour 7" last Fall and it's out today digitally for the first time, check out "I Don't Want You Anyway" wherever you digitally enjoy music!
